The street in brief

Downavon is mostly sem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£321,000 — roughly 20% below the BA15 norm. On floor area that works out near £3,351 per square metre, below the district's £4,062. The street has been outpacing the BA15 trend. With 7 sales across 6 homes since 2020, the street turns over frequently.

Downavon's £321,000 median sits about 20% below BA15's £400,000; on floor space it runs £3,351/m² against the district's £4,062/m² (-18%).

Street and BA15 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
